BN Clean is a bio-agent developed to improve the sanitary environment of water areas that are familiar to us, such as kitchens and toilets. Its main component is safe and harmless useful microorganisms (BN bacteria) that decompose bad odors and fats, making it gentle on both humans and the environment, allowing for safe use. It is a unique strain of microorganisms discovered and developed by Meiji Co., Ltd. in the late 1980s at the Pharmaceutical Research Institute of Meiji Seika Kaisha, Ltd. (at that time), in Yokohama. Originally, research and development began for applications in pharmaceuticals, but as investigations progressed, it was found to have excellent fat-decomposing abilities and confirmed safety, leading to its commercialization as a bio-agent. In 1994, it was launched as the commercial environmental purification bio-agent "BN Clean." This microorganism is generally classified as Bacillus subtilis (a member of the natto bacteria) and has been named Bacillus subtilis BN1001 as a new species with excellent fat-decomposing capabilities.

Applications/Examples of results
■ Grease trap: Decomposes and reduces scum, suppresses bad odors, removes clogs in drainage pipes ■ Organic waste treatment: Promotes decomposition of organic waste, deodorizes organic waste ■ Wastewater treatment: Reduces and decomposes fats, decreases excess sludge, emulsifies fats ■ Public toilets: Deodorizes toilets ■ Livestock: Deodorizes livestock facilities, deodorizes waste
